The structural intricacy of an effective Ceiling Fan Installation includes handling extreme kinetic forces and guaranteeing long-lasting mechanical stability. Since a working fan runs with continuous rotational torque, its weight circulation creates vibrant tension that far exceeds that of static lighting components. Requirement technical guidelines dictate that the mounting assembly needs to never ever depend on plasterboard alone; instead, it needs direct anchoring to durable timber noggins or specialized metal brackets safely repaired in between ceiling joists. This structural foundation avoids micro-vibrations from gradually destabilizing the surrounding ceiling materials and removes the disruptive humming noises typically triggered by insecure mounts. In addition, technical teams utilize accuracy balancing packages to align the pitch of each blade completely, getting rid of the structural wobble that results in premature motor wear and jeopardizes the supreme safety of the indoor environment.

Spatial preparation is another crucial measurement of a modern-day Ceiling Fan Installation, as particular horizontal and vertical clearances should be strictly kept to ensure security and efficiency. Structure regulations mandate that fan blades must remain a minimum of two point one metres above the flooring level to get rid of any possibility of accidental physical contact. In homes with low or standard ceilings, compact, flush-mounted designs are carefully integrated to keep the area open and practical without compromising headroom. For homes including raked ceilings, loft areas, or spacious open-plan styles, specialized extension rods are used to position the blades at the ideal height for air blending. This exact positioning avoids aerodynamic cavitation, an inefficiency that happens when a fan is put too near a flat surface area, making sure that the produced air present reaches the living zones effectively.

The technical scope of a Ceiling Fan Installation has broadened substantially due to contemporary developments in motor efficiency and clever home integration. Homeowner frequently shift from standard Alternating Current systems to innovative brushless Direct Existing options, which take in a fraction of the power and run with near-silent mechanics. These modern-day systems depend on compact digital receivers concealed within the ceiling canopy to procedure signals from cordless controllers and central home automation networks. Accredited installers make sure these delicate electronic systems are perfectly isolated and mapped onto devoted circuits to protect them from external grid spikes and prevent the nuisance tripping of family security switches.
